About R. H. Cantrell
R. H. Cantrell is a scholar working on Aerospace Engineering, Mechanics of Materials and Fluid Flow and Transfer Processes, having authored 15 papers that have together received 335 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Rocket and propulsion systems research (11 papers), Spacecraft and Cryogenic Technologies (6 papers), Energetic Materials and Combustion (5 papers), Advanced Thermodynamic Systems and Engines (3 papers), Radiation Dose and Imaging (2 papers), Advanced X-ray and CT Imaging (2 papers), Aerodynamics and Acoustics in Jet Flows (2 papers) and Planetary Science and Exploration (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Aerospace Engineering (274 citations), Computational Mechanics (146 citations) and Mechanics of Materials (130 citations). R. H. Cantrell has collaborated with scholars based in United States. Frequent co-authors include R. W. Hart, F. T. McClure, Michael B. Zellner, H.E. Martz and Kyle Champley. Their work appears in journals such as The Journal of the Acoustical Society of America, AIAA Journal and Combustion and Flame.
